Senor Mex Says: This post hit the nail on the head in more ways than one. First of all, the point about U.S. insurance policies being invalid south of the border is right on the money. This fact doesn’t just apply to the U.S. though, the same thing is true about Canadian car insurance policies, which are valid in the States but not down in Mexico. Confusing, right? It is true that neither type of policy is officially recognized down in Mexico. If you end up in an accident and show the authorities your U.S. car insurance policy, they will shrug and ask to see your Mexico insurance. In rare instances, U.S. or Canadian insurance may provide limited coverage within a very small zone right along the border. There are so many caveats involved here, though, that its always best to protect yourself with an honest to goodness Mexico insurance policy anyway.
The other point that I wanted to discuss from this post involves international driving permits. While they can provide benefits, they are nowhere near as important as car insurance for Mexico. An international driving permit is truly optional; there is no direct benefit involved in buying or keeping this type of permit on you. “‘Many people are not aware that U.S. auto insurance is not valid in Mexico, said AAA Northern California spokesperson Cynthia Harris. ‘Only a Mexican automobile liability policy issued by an authorized Mexican insurance company is accepted by local authorities.'”
“If you are planning on driving in Mexico, you may want to purchase an International Driving Permit. Valid in more than 150 countries, the permit contains your name, photo, and translated driver license information, effectively communicating to foreign officials that you are an authorized driver.”
